CANYON, Texas – The #4 Lady Buffs of West Texas A&M overcame a slow start on Thursday night as they trailed by as many as 12 points in the second period before ending the first half on a 13-0 to top the Drovers of University of Science & Arts, 71-42 in exhibition action at the First United Bank Center in Canyon.

HOW IT HAPPENED:
- West Texas A&M was led offensively byÂ
Lexy Hightower who went 8-of-13 from the floor including 3-of-6 from behind the arc to finish the night with 21 points followed by
Tyesha Taylor with 10 points to go along with nine rebounds,
Megan Gamble dished out a game-high four assists while
Deleyah Harris had three steals.
- Â Reyna Ammons and Taylor Alexander led the way for the Drovers with 10 points each followed by Tori James and Jaye Cage with seven, Amanda Gibson grabbed five rebounds while Trinity Smitherman had three steals.

UP NEXT:
The Lady Buffs now take a break for fall finals as they return to action on December 17-18 as they head to Fort Lauderdale, Florida to take park in the Cruzin Classic presented by Trip Sports at the Broward County Convention Center with matchups scheduled against Barry and Palm Beach Atlantic.
